Output e4bc6e54eabeba23cd73e9dcb6cc6ff4d896d2e6ca7c4339d93c99cc30712d2f:1

value
39749290
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a630671dfa887b95f37caeaf226c2bcbbbfbce4 OP_EQUALVERIFY OP_CHECKSIG
address
17nKdawjg3JhDiTynMa9yAgQwK8nGLCD1E
transaction
e4bc6e54eabeba23cd73e9dcb6cc6ff4d896d2e6ca7c4339d93c99cc30712d2f
confirmations
538818
spent
true